The perfect 2 days Brecon Beacons road trip
Day 1
Gorge Walking in Waterfall Country
Scramble through the river gorge, navigate small waterfalls, and enjoy the thrill of the Brecon Beacons' natural playground.
The Old Waterwheel Tearoom
A charming tearoom serving light lunches, homemade cakes, and local Welsh specialties.
Four Falls Trail Hike
Embark on a circular walk visiting four distinct waterfalls, including the famous Sgwd yr Eira, which you can walk behind.
Waterfall Country Campsite
A well-maintained campsite located close to the waterfalls, ideal for experiencing the natural beauty of the area.
The Lamb Inn
A traditional pub in Pontneddfechan, serving hearty meals and local ales.
Day 2
Sgwd yr Eira walk-behind waterfall
Hike to Sgwd yr Eira, a stunning waterfall you can walk behind, for a unique and memorable experience.
The Red Lion Inn
A traditional pub located in Penderyn, offering a cozy atmosphere and classic pub fare.
Pen y Fan Hike (Short Route)
Take a shorter, more accessible route to the summit of Pen y Fan for panoramic views (weather permitting!).
